    Linkwood 11 Year Old 2013 - Milroy's Soho Selection

    This 11-year-old Linkwood from a single American oak hogshead brings all the easy elegance the Speyside distillery is loved for. Bottled for the Milroy’s Soho Selection, it leans into a dessert-like profile filled with orchard fruit, soft pastry notes and sweet, creamy touches.

    Tasting Note by The Producer

    Nose

    An aromatic nose opens with lemon peels and cut grass notes, lifted by fresh green apple and melon. Milk chocolate follows, along with raspberries, butter icing, and a touch of pear drop sweets. Vanilla pods, croissants and iced buns provide an even sweeter complement, kept balanced with a touch of black pepper.

    Palate

    A gentle, elegant palate opens with an abundance of citrus peels and sweet spices. The orchard fruits are more cooked now – think: pear tatin, golden syrup and vanilla custard. Fruit salad sweets, and pineapple come through, with a touch of pepper and chilli spice to add texture.

    Finish

    Long with lingering dessert notes and baking spices.
